The name "Topanga" itself was inspired by Topanga Canyon, a scenic area near Los Angeles known for its artistic community and natural beauty, which influenced the character's early "flower child" persona [10]. Today, the name continues to be associated with local California history and trendy retail destinations like Topanga Plaza [5, 22].

Topanga Lawrence, played by Danielle Fishel in Boy Meets World, is celebrated as a 1990s cultural icon, recognized for her distinct fashion, free-spirited style, and character development from eccentric classmate to a driven young woman. Actress Danielle Fishel continues to engage with the show's legacy through the "Pod Meets World" rewatch podcast and her hair care line, Be Free, which references her iconic 90s look. Exclusive Rewards: Loyalty programs often provide "early access to exclusive drops" and special birthday gifts for teen members. 2. The Artistic Scene: Topanga Canyon Gallery The Topanga Canyon Gallery
is a long-standing cooperative that showcases local artists. While it is a fine arts venue, its history is deeply tied to the Topanga hippie subculture and the "flower children" of the 1960s.
Solo Exhibitions: The gallery hosts exclusive receptions for local artists, such as the "Color by Numbers" exhibit by LED artist Mark Estes.
